Abstract
1. The effects of (-)-isoprenaline and the new β-adrenoceptor agonist, MJ-9184-1, on the lungs, on the cardiovascular system, and on slow contracting skeletal muscle have been compared in cats under chloralose anaesthesia.Keywords
